Admin of this site !
Happy with this site?

I love it 83% 83% ( 25 )
Yes very much so 10% 10% ( 3 )
Yes it's not bad 3% 3% ( 1 )
Not happy, I am leaving 3% 3% ( 1 )
I am paid to be here 0% 0% ( 0 )

Total de votos : 30
Good to know when you write to them, they promptly answer any questions.

Also like the approval system which releases sets a few at a time so as not to flush the recently added photos page like hell every 5 minutes.

A good site which seems to be run by humans

